Chelle_Rydz (chellerydz) | 21 comments Finished Broken (In the Best Possible Way) by Jenny Lawson

๐Ÿ•๏ธ๐ŸฅพThe CLIMB (so far)
Book 4 up Mt. Wychproof

โ˜…โ˜…โ˜…โ˜…โ˜…

This book made me laugh, and cry; sometimes in the same sentence or two. I love how open Lawson is about her mental and physical struggles. They resonate with me like they do for so many people out there. She makes people feel less alone, and less strange. I know I always feel better after reading one of Lawson's books.
And she's just so damn funny!
Thanks to GoodReads for the ARC I won in a giveaway. I also bought the audiobook because for Jenny's books I need both. Audio is the way to go if you only pick one, but I also love seeing the photos and drawings in physical book format.
